Study discovers crocodile jaws are super-sensitive
Crocodilians are more sensitive to touch than humans

Researchers in the US have discovered that the dome-shaped dots along the jaws of alligators and crocodiles are in fact more sensitive to pressure and vibration than human fingertips. Previously it was believed these freckle-like features were for camouflage, but they have turned out to be much more complex.

The neuroscientists who conducted the study suggest the sensitive spots play a major part in the aquatic reptiles' impressive reaction times when hunting. The technical name for the spots is integumentary sensor organs (ISOs).

Scientists over the years have speculated over the spot’s functions – from secreting oil to detecting electrical fields. However, a study in 2002 suggested that they detected ripples made by water, which led to the latest research.

Co-author Duncan Leitch, of Vanderbilt University, Nashville, commented that the jaws of crocodiles seem to be unique and can almost be said to perform some of the tactile functions of human hands.
In the lab, Mr Leitch tested how the features reacted to a variety of stimuli. He found no reaction to salinity or electrical fields but touch was a key trigger.

He explained: "When I used a calibrated series of fibres to touch or tickle the [bumps], I found that they were responsive to forces finer than our own fingertips – a sensory system widely studied for its own sensitivity.”

“Although crocodilians are certainly not the ancestors to humans, it is interesting to see how different parts of their forebrain may have evolved to process different sensations," Mr Leitch continued. "One goal with a lot of this research is gaining a better understanding of how very different nervous systems have evolved to solve similar problems."

Submissions open for BSAVA Clinical Research Abstracts 2026

News Story 1
 The BSAVA has opened submissions for the BSAVA Clinical Research Abstracts 2026.

It is an opportunity for applicants to present new research on any veterinary subject, such as the preliminary results of a study, discussion of a new technique or a description of an interesting case.

They must be based on high-quality clinical research conducted in industry, practice or academia, and summarised in 250 words.

Applications are welcome from vets, vet nurses, practice managers, and students.

Submissions are open until 6 March 2026.

Survey seeks ruminant sector views on antimicrobial stewardship

A new survey is seeking views of people working in the UK ruminant sector on how to tackle the challenge of demonstrating responsible antibiotic stewardship.

Forming part of a wider, collaborative initiative, the results will help identify the types of data available so that challenges with data collection can be better understood and addressed.

Anyone working in the UK farming sector, including vets and farmers,is encouraged to complete the survey, which is available at app.onlinesurveys.jisc.ac.uk
